Antenna Measurements

The development of antenna measurements techniques has evolved over time, with new measurements or methods of measurement being introduced to get around difficulties. The measuremenst are broken into:

Radiation Pattern Measurement

- Angle of radiation

- Far Field antenna ranges

- Near Field antenna ranges

Impedance Measurement

- Smith Chart

- Impedance bandwidth

Polarization

Gain and Front to Back ratios

Efficiency

Antenna Structures

- Wind loading

- Ice Loading

- Bandwidth

- Noise Figure, critically important in satellite and radio astronomy application.

- Power Handling

Related, and often integral to antenna measurements is the use of impedance matching devices (elsewhere).
